York RSPCA Overwhelmed by Sudden Arrival of 48 Guinea Pigs

In a surprising turn of events, the York RSPCA centre found itself suddenly inundated with the arrival of 48 guinea pigs. The unexpected influx of these furry creatures left the staff shocked and scrambling to provide adequate care for their new charges. Centre manager Ruth McCabe expressed her astonishment, stating, “We’ve never had a sudden intake of such a large amount of animals.”

The arrival of the guinea pigs was not a planned event, but rather the result of a tragic circumstance. The animals were donated to the RSPCA following the death of their previous owner, leaving them in need of new homes and care.
